
AlexSandroJAP
Membros-
Total de itens
22 -
Registro em
-
Última visita
Tudo que AlexSandroJAP postou
-
Olá, dá pra enviar email com anexo atraves de formulario utilizando ajax?
-
beleza, até estou tentando algo assim, mas o que e não sei é justamente qual evento ocorre nesse "voltar" para dentro dele eu conseguir setar a cidade já selecionada anteriormente. tem alguma indicação de material em portugues que eu possa me treinar nesse assunto? Alex Sandro
-
Tem dois combos: Estado e Cidades. Eles são alimentados dinamicamente sem refresh. A validação do form é feita na pagina submetida do form (ou seja, em outra pagina). Quando há alguma coisa que não é validade e preciso retornar para correção eu utilizo um echo '<script language="javascript">java script:history.go(-1);</script>' para voltar. Só que nesse voltar o campo estado vem preenchido, mas o campo cidade não. O usuario precisa preencher novamente.
-
Show de bola amigo, deu certinho. Agora ele já esta trazendo a lista de cidades preenchidas, mas o campo em branco. Porque ele perde a informação da cidade? att Alex Sandro
-
Olá, ainda não consegui resolver.... onde coloco isso? porque quando o programa da um voltar "echo '<script language="javascript">java script:history.go(-1);</script>';" ele não recarrega a pagina novamente... (pra não perder os dados digitados). Tentei colocando assim na pagina que o form chama no submite: echo '<script language="javascript">java script:history.go(-1);</script>'; echo '<script type="text/javascript">$("select[name=estado]").trigger("change");</script>'; exit; mas não de.. o codigo no arq do form para carregar os combos estao assim: <script type="text/javascript"> $(document).ready(function(){ $("select[name=estado]").change(function(){ $("select[name=cidade]").html('<option value="0">Carregando...</option>'); $.post("cidades.php", {estado:$(this).val()}, function(valor){ $("select[name=cidade]").html(valor); } ) }) }) </script> já deve ter dado pra perceber que não manjo muito de jquery... se puder me ajudar agradeço muito. abraço
-
Olá, tenho uma pagina com um formulario de cadastro que os campos estado e cidade são preenchido dinamicamente. Estes campos não são validados, porem alguns outros são. Valido isso no arquivo php que recebe o form, e caso haja algum erro eu retorno a pagina. O problema é que quando retorno a pagina o estado esta preenchido, mas a cidade não. E no combo de cidade tb não tem nada. então preciso escolher outro estado para assim ocorrer o evento change e voltar no estado correto para carregar a lista de cidades. alguém saberia uma saida? quanto a validação precisa realmente ser feita no arq q recebe o form. alex sandro
-
Olá Amigos de fórum, estou desenvolvendo um site e nele tem um form de contato, dentro deste form tem um combo chamado departamento. Eu pretendo usar esse form para qualquer contato dentro do site e em algumas paginas eu criei links para esse form de contato. Os itens desse combo são fixo e feitos com html simples. Eu queria saber uma forma de quando criar um link para esse form, conseguir chamar esse form e deixar selecionado o departamento de acordo com a situação. Por exemplo <a href="contato.php?departamento=compras">formulario de contato para essa questao</a> E que quando abrir o form o departamento compras esteja selecionado. Agradeço qualquer ajuda!
-
Olá amigos, estou batalhando em fazer uma página que a pessoa escolha a cidade em um combobox e eu retorne os vendedores com seus respectivos telefones que atendem essa cidade. Até consegui fazer, mais estou retornando os dados em um textarea (de um form) pois estou me baseando em um exemplo que usa form, mas eu queria retornar esses dados em uma tabela para poder "tabular" e formatar e "zebrar" as linhas. Mas aqui peço a ajuda dos amigos apenas para jogar esse resultado em uma tabela e não textarea como esta atualmente. segue meu código: index.php <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title>xxx</title> <link href="css/css.css" rel="stylesheet" type="text/css" /> <script type="text/javascript" src="js/jquery-1.3.2.min.js"></script> <script type="text/javascript"> $(document).ready(function(){ $("select[name=cidade]").change(function(){ $("textarea[name=vendedor]").html('Carregando...'); $.post("vendedor.php", {cidade:$(this).val()}, function(valor){ $("textarea[name=vendedor]").html(valor); } ) }) }) </script> </head> <body> <form action="" method="post"> <select name="cidade"> <option value="0">Escolha uma Cidade</option> <?php mysql_connect("localhost", "root", ""); mysql_select_db("baseDeDados"); $sql = "SELECT * FROM cidades ORDER BY nome ASC"; $qr = mysql_query($sql) or die(mysql_error()); while($ln = mysql_fetch_assoc($qr)){ echo '<option value="'.$ln['id'].'">'.$ln['nome'].'</option>'; } ?> </select> <br /><br /><br /> <textarea name="vendedor" cols="50" rows="5"></textarea> </form> </body> </html> vendedor.php <?php mysql_connect("localhost", "root", ""); mysql_select_db("baseDeDados"); $cidade = $_POST['cidade']; $sql = "SELECT * FROM vendedores WHERE vendedores.id IN (SELECT cidade_vendedor.id_vendedor FROM cidade_vendedor WHERE cidade_vendedor.id_cidade = '$cidade')"; $qr = mysql_query($sql) or die(mysql_error()); if(mysql_num_rows($qr) == 0){ echo 'Sem vendedor cadastrado'; } else { while($ln = mysql_fetch_assoc($qr)){ echo 'Vendedor: '.$ln['nome'].' - Telefone: '.$ln['telefone']."\n"; } } ?> agradeço qualquer ajuda!
-
Olá amigos, estou precisando de uma luz. Em um form para cadastro de doações para uma creche estou tentando validar o form com jquery. Até que os campos basicos derao certo(nome, cpf, end, tel...), mas nesse form tb tem 4 "radios", sendo 20,00 | 30,00 | 50,00 e o quarto e ultimo radio ativa um input pra propria pessoa informar o valor. O problema é validar isso com plugin validate. então resolvi fazer um function testando se foi selecionado um deles e se foi o ultimo que o valor do input seja maio q zero. Porem estou validando essa funcao no onSubmit do form, mas ele dá a mensagem que esta no form mais não barra do form ser enviado. alguém sabe se existe a possibilidade de trabalhar com esses dois em conjunto? <script type="text/javascript"> $(document).ready(function() { //Mascaras $("#cpf").mask("999.999.999-99"); $("#telefone").mask("(99) 9999-9999"); $("#celular").mask("(99) 9999-9999"); $("#cep").mask("99.999-999"); $('#valorespontaneo').priceFormat( { prefix: '', centsSeparator: ',', thousandsSeparator: '.', limit: 7, centsLimit: 2 }); //Validação $("#formsejacolaborador").validate( { rules: { nome: {required: true}, cpf: {required: true, cpf: true}, telefone: {required: true}, celular: {notEqual: "#telefone"}, endereco: {required: true}, numero: {required: true}, bairro: {required: true}, cidade: {required: true}, estado: {required: true}, cep: {required: true}, email: {required: false, email: true} }, messages: { nome: {required: 'Preenchimento Obrigatório'}, cpf: {required: 'Preenchimento Obrigatório', cpf: 'CPF Inválido!'}, telefone: {required: 'Preenchimento Obrigatório'}, celular: {notEqual: 'Opcional. Mas deve ser diferente do "Telefone"'}, endereco: {required: 'Preenchimento Obrigatório'}, numero: {required: 'Preenchimento Obrigatório'}, bairro: {required: 'Preenchimento Obrigatório'}, cidade: {required: 'Preenchimento Obrigatório'}, estado: {required: 'Preenchimento Obrigatório'}, cep: {required: 'Preenchimento Obrigatório'}, email: {required: 'Preenchimento Opcional', email: 'Opcional. Mas precisa ser válido'} } }); }); </script> <script> function validaApenasValorContribuicao() { f = document.formsejacolaborador; marcado = -1; for(i=0; i<f.valor.length; i++) { if(f.valor[i].checked) { marcado = i; } } if(marcado == -1) { alert("Escolha 'Valor de Contribuição'"); f.valor[0].focus(); return false; } else if((marcado == 3) && (f.valorespontaneo.value == "0,00")) { alert("Valor precisa ser diferente de '0,00'"); f.valorespontaneo.focus(); return false; } return true; } </script> <form id="formsejacolaborador" name="formsejacolaborador" method="post" action="enviaemailsejacolaborador.php" onSubmit="return validaApenasValorContribuicao();" > Abraços
-
Jonathan, mas seria o mesmo livro para AJAX e JS?
-
Olá amigos, estou tentando desenvolver uma area restrita para o meu site e acho que preciso estudar um pouco mais, queria fazer algo que não ficasse carregando a pagina a todo comando, então pesquisei e descobri o AJAX. alguém poderia indicar um bom livro para aprender (em portugues)?
-
Olá colegas de fórum, no meu site eu tenho um SlideShow que funciona beleza. Só que tenho que dizer pra ele o nome das imagens que deve pegar. Teria como adaptar para que pegasse todas as imagens dentro de um determinado diretório? Atualmente o código esta assim: var Pic = new Array() Pic[0] = '/imagens/slideshow/produtoseservicos/slideshow1.jpg' Pic[1] = '/imagens/slideshow/produtoseservicos/slideshow2.jpg' Pic[2] = '/imagens/slideshow/produtoseservicos/slideshow3.jpg' Pic[3] = '/imagens/slideshow/produtoseservicos/slideshow4.jpg' Eu estava tentando algo +/- assim: File dir = new File("/imagens/slideshow/index"); File files[]; files = dir.listFiles(); alert(files); File imagens[]; for(int i = 0; i < files.length; i++) { if(files[i].toString().endsWith(".jpg")) { Pic[j] = files[i]; j++; } } Mais num ta dando certo não heheh abraços
-
Olá amigo, vamos lá: Isso é o inicio do meu arquivo da pagina que contem o form, que é '.html' (O form esta saindo ok, mas a pagina não) <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/html;"> <link href="../css/estilos.css" rel="stylesheet" type="text/css" /> <title> Depois tem o arquivo .php que enviar o email Abraços
-
ESerra, valeu pela dica, mas sem querer abusar.. devo colocar essa linha no meu arquivo "enviaemail.php"? $headers .= 'Content-type: text/html; charset=iso-8859-1' . "\r\n"; Abraços
-
Olá galera, estou quase enlouquecendo, pois fiz um form de contato no meu site que envia os dados pro meu email e quando passo as informações pro arquivo PHP os caracteres "ç, ~´`^" vão todos zuados. Pesquisei e me pareceu que a solução esta próximo da TAG: <meta ht....>. O padrão da minha página (que foi desenvolvida no Dreamweaver) estava como: <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> Alterei para: <meta http-equiv="Content-Type" content="text/html;"> Usando esse último os dados vão certo, mas a página fica desconfigurada.. estou meio sem saber o que fazer... atualmente ou funciona um ou outro, assim fica dificil hahaha Agradeço qualquer ajuda! Abraços
-
Valeu amigão, brigado mesmo. Abraços Alex Sandro
-
você responde rapido mesmo rsss seguinte, percebe no print q entorno do arq do flash tem um borda branca? pois bem, essa q eu quero tirar, que o slide seja exatamente do tamanho das fotos. E o que acho mais feio é q a borda superior é mais fina e inferior mais grossa, isso fica feio.. Esse arq flash foi feito no proprio Dream com o componente Image Viewer. e nas propriedades dele não existe, pelo menos ao meu ver, como tirar isso.. abraço
-
Ola Viny, consegui disponibilizar a imagem. Por favor, acesse a pagina www.japrogramacao.com.br/exemplo.html. Lá tem o print do proprio Dream Valeu
-
Estou com dificudades para coloca-la na web daqui de onde estou, mais tarde coloco. Valeu.
-
Ola, obrigado pela dica, mas eu copiei todo o codigo, colei no bloco de notas e procurei por todos "border" e todos estao como border="0" e ainda continua com as tais bordas, se puder acessar http://www.japrogramacao.com.br/exemplo.html lá verá exatamente o que esta ocorrendo. valeu
-
Ola galera, estou começando com o Dreamweaver e estou fazendo uma página na qual coloquei um slide show (image viewer), como se faz para tirar a borda que ele criar automaticamente, ou pelo menos dividi-la por igual. Pois fica muito feio, a borda superior é fininha e a inferior grossa. Já tentei de tudo.. agradeço qualquer ajuda Abraços Alex Sandro
-
Olá Amigos, sou novo por aqui (e em VB tb rs). Seguinte, estou findando um projeto academico e me faltam alguns detalhes. Queria saber se algum colega sabe como fazer um relatorio em Data Report com agrupamento. Eu consegui chegar em um codigo mas sem agrupamento, e eu preciso agrupar (separar os dados). Abaixo codigo que estou trabalhando: Sub GerarRelTst() Set Rs = CNN.Execute("select nome, contato1, email, regional from equipe order by regional desc, nome") If Rs.EOF = False Then Set DRSample.DataSource = Rs DRSample.Show End If End Sub Dessa forma o código fica bem simples, fácil entendimento e manutenção, utilizo a mesma conexao da aplicação porem não consigo agrupa-lo. Tentei um outro jeito utilizando Data Enverioment mas ele não esta atualizando os dados na mesma conexão. Agradeço qualquer ajuda Alex Sandro